Kernel Group (NASDAQ:KRNL) and Altitude Acquisition (NASDAQ:ALTU) are both small-cap unclassified companies, but which is the better investment? We will contrast the two companies based on the strength of their media sentiment, dividends, institutional ownership, earnings, valuation, community ranking, profitability, analyst recommendations and risk.
Kernel Group has a beta of 0.02, indicating that its stock price is 98% less volatile than the S&P 500. Comparatively, Altitude Acquisition has a beta of -0.05, indicating that its stock price is 105% less volatile than the S&P 500.
44.4% of Kernel Group shares are held by institutional investors. Comparatively, 7.0% of Altitude Acquisition shares are held by institutional investors. 53.8% of Kernel Group shares are held by company insiders. Comparatively, 85.0% of Altitude Acquisition shares are held by company insiders. Strong institutional ownership is an indication that hedge funds, endowments and large money managers believe a stock is poised for long-term growth.
Kernel Group and Altitude Acquisition both received 0 outperform votes by MarketBeat users.
In the previous week, Kernel Group had 2 more articles in the media than Altitude Acquisition. MarketBeat recorded 2 mentions for Kernel Group and 0 mentions for Altitude Acquisition. Kernel Group's average media sentiment score of 0.43 beat Altitude Acquisition's score of 0.00 indicating that Kernel Group is being referred to more favorably in the media.
Summary
Kernel Group beats Altitude Acquisition on 5 of the 7 factors compared between the two stocks.
